Black goo in coolant reservoir - what is it? Posted by Tulsaab [Email] (#31) [Profile/Gallery] (more from Tulsaab) on Mon, 14 Sep 2015 08:24:17 Members do not see ads below this line. - Help Keep This Site Online - Signup |
'07 9-5 Aero Combi -
Was looking under the hood yesterday and noticed my coolant had changed from a bright orange to a murky brown color. When opening the cap, the coolant is still a brilliant dexcool orange and has the same smell/consistency, but the sides of the tank are lined with a brownish/black slime. It doesn't seem like oil, as there's no oil floating on the top of the coolant and it doesn't seem greasy - just lining the sides.
Is this oil, ATF, or could this be residual from a failing hose? I replaced the upper rad hose a few years back with a URO hose which seemed to have questionable quality - i'm wondering if this could be it. Thoughts?
